Health and Healthcare

 


The following curriculum framework and pacing guide outlines Health and Healthcare, Literacy Volunteers’ third six-week EL/Civics session, which began in mid-September, 2002. Unlike sessions 1 and 2, this session is a single session devoted exclusively to healthcare and related grammar skills. Users will find below a short description of each lesson and an accompanying timeline for this class of intermediate level English learners. Virtually all of the materials and activities described here are easily adapted to meet the needs of learners at other levels of competency.  

 

Health and Healthcare borrows from portions of the two previous sessions while adding a number of new lessons. Like its predecessors, this session will build basic health and healthcare vocabulary and questioning skills within the context of authentic situations. However, special emphasis has been placed upon extending previous skills acquisitions into the area of verbal communication. As a result, the lessons in this session are weighed heavily in favor of speaking and listening activities featuring learner dialogues.

Session Objectives

The learner will correctly identify, spell and pronounce unit vocabulary and conjugate unit verbs.


The learner will correctly identify nouns, articles, verbs and adjectives in written and oral work.

 

The learner will correctly use the frequency adverbs "never," "seldom," "often," "usually," "always," "rarely" and "sometimes" in healthcare related sentences.

 

The learner will use "Who?", "Where?", "What?" and "Is there?/Are there?" questioning formats to ask and answer questions related to health care.

 

The learner will write dialogues and perform role plays using health vocabulary and appropriate questioning formats.

 

The learner will match body parts with the verb(s) that correctly describe their function.

 

The learner will complete a sample Confidential Health Intake Form with fewer than three errors.
